Dangerous Thoughts (side quest)

Perhaps it was not what Chance and Aguri expected when they agreed to help the scroll-smith, but it was too late to back out. They were inside his mind now. Sort of. Their minds were inside his mind? Their thoughts were inside his dreams? Whatever. The process had involved complicated magics, and trances, and drinking certain potions, all while lying in a circle holding hands. They had all drifted off to sleep and now Chance and Aguri awoke in a room they did not recognize.

Mr. Wazowitz, the scroll-smith, had hired the barbarian and thief to retrieve an item for him. An item that he somehow managed to stow away in the one place he considered to be safest. Within the fortress of his own mind. He had informed the duo that the item was guarded by traps and monsters, but probably nothing the two couldn't handle. After all, when he set up his mental defenses, he merely wanted his secret well-guarded and protected, but not impossible to retrieve.

And so Aguri and Chance found themselves standing in a circular wooden room with no doors or windows, nestled firmly somewhere within the recesses of Mr. Wazowitz's mindscape. The two adventurers still had all of their gear and felt like they were at full health, and the scroll-smith assured them that reality would operate essentially the same as the real world. The main difference being that any resources they used and damage the accrued would not follow them when they exited his mind. Death, however, was a trickier business. If they died in his mind, there was a very real chance that they would not wake back up when all was said and done. Which is why Mr. Wazowitz agreed to a fairly hefty payment if they succeeded.

After a moment or two, the adventurers came to notice a few more details about the room they were in. It was circular, about twenty feet across with a twenty foot high ceiling. The walls were made of tall wooden panels, and the floor was made of square wooden tiles decorated with engraved images of plants and animals. The entire area smelled a bit musty and the air was quite humid. A blackish green ooze dripped occasionally from the cracks in the ceiling tiles. There were no clear ways in or out of the room, but every so often an indistinct sound could be heard on the other side of the wall.

What do you do?

Dangerous Thoughts (side quest)

As Aguri walked along the walls, trailing a hand against their surface, she could tell that the wood paneling was rather thin. It would not take a lot of effort to break through. The sounds on the other side, however, made that choice of action questionable at best. It sounded like the low warning growl of some beast, and it followed Aguri as she moved along the wall. Save for one section of the wall where the sound subsided.

Looking at the tiles on the floor, Aguri noticed that in the same section of the room as the "silent spot," the tiles on the floor showed images of animals like beavers, woodpeckers, termites and carpenter ants. Whereas the tiles further away along the other sections of wall showed images of oaks, willows, baobabs, and sequoias.

Chance would have surely noticed the same thing, except as soon as he leaned over to examine the floor, a glob of goop from the ceiling landed on the back of his shoulders. It was only a small bit, no bigger than a marble, but it melted a hole straight through his leather armor and shirt beneath like a hot knife through butter. He felt an intense burning sensation as if his skin was literally boiling where the glob had landed.

Of course Aguri saw Chance's reaction to the burning goop, and quickly noticed that the drips were beginning to occur more frequently and in more areas. The duo had maybe a minute before the room was filled with a rain of the blackish green goop!

What do you do?
